Living World 1!

  We can't classify an organism as living just by looking at it but there are some parameters that are taken into consideration. Such as if a body or organism can perform locomotion, excretion, and photosynthesis then we can say that a body is living! There are two types of features: 1. Characteristic feature: Characters or features which are common in both non-living and living but aren't a specific feature that we can call an organism living. 2. Defining features: Features that can be seen in only living. They are only seen in the living organism. Growth, reproduction, ability to sense the environment and mount a suitable response come to our mind immediately as unique features of living organisms. Let's check out the defining and characteristic features of living organisms:  1. Growth: All living organisms grow.
